Import and export Group Wikis
What does this MR do?
In this MR we add the logic to import and export group wikis (and all the group wikis of any descendant group). We're adding a new exporter and restorer in the respective group import and export service.
The changes are behind a feature flag.

Steps to test it
In local development, create a group and a subgroup and enable the feature flag group_wiki_import_export
. Then, in each one of them, click on the group's wiki and create a wiki page (it's located in the group's main page).
After creating the wiki pages go to the main group Settings > General > Advanced > Export group section and click on the Export group
button:
Once clicked, the page will reload. It will take a couple of seconds (remember to have a fresh Sidekiq, usually when changing between branches it gets stucked) but after (you might need to reload the page again), the button Download Export
will appear:
If you open the downloaded file, you would see a structure similar to the image in the description, with a repositories
folder, and one .bundle
file per each wiki repo.
Well, now it's time to import it. For that, we can go to the +
icon and click on New Group
.
There we can go to the Import group
tab, fill the details and upload the downloaded export file.
Once the import is completed, we should have the same group structure, and each group and subgroup should have a wiki with the pages we created.
